createMarketplaceItemLabels

POST
/inbound/fba/2024-03-20/items/labels
Fulfillment Inbound
Last modified:2024-12-05 08:51:44
Maintainer:Not configured
For a given marketplace - creates labels for a list of MSKUs.
Usage Plan:
Rate (requests per second)Burst
230
The x-amzn-RateLimit-Limit response header returns the usage plan rate limits that were applied to the requested operation, when available. The preceding table contains the default rate and burst values for this operation. Selling partners whose business demands require higher throughput may have higher rate and burst values than those shown here. For more information, refer to Usage Plans and Rate Limits in the Selling Partner API.

Request

Body Params application/json
The `createMarketplaceItemLabels` request.
height
number 
optional
The height of the item label.
>= 25<= 100
labelType
enum<string> 
required
Indicates the type of print type for a given label.
Allowed values:
STANDARD_FORMATTHERMAL_PRINTING
Example:
STANDARD_FORMAT
localeCode
string 
optional
The locale code constructed from ISO 639 language code and 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 standard of country codes separated by an underscore character.
Default:
en_US
Match pattern:
^[a-z]{2}_[A-Z]{2}$
marketplaceId
string 
required
The Marketplace ID. For a list of possible values, refer to Marketplace IDs.
>= 1 characters<= 20 characters
mskuQuantities
array[object (MskuQuantity) {2}] 
required
Represents the quantity of an MSKU to print item labels for.
>= 1 items<= 100 items
msku
string 
required
The merchant SKU, a merchant-supplied identifier for a specific SKU.
>= 1 characters<= 40 characters
quantity
integer 
required
A positive integer.
>= 1<= 10000
pageType
enum<string> 
optional
The page type to use to print the labels. Possible values: 'A4_21', 'A4_24', 'A4_24_64x33', 'A4_24_66x35', 'A4_24_70x36', 'A4_24_70x37', 'A4_24i', 'A4_27', 'A4_40_52x29', 'A4_44_48x25', 'Letter_30'.
Allowed values:
A4_21A4_24A4_24_64x33A4_24_66x35A4_24_70x36A4_24_70x37A4_24iA4_27A4_40_52x29A4_44_48x25Letter_30
Example:
A4_21
width
number 
optional
The width of the item label.
>= 25<= 100
Example
{
    "height": 25,
    "labelType": "STANDARD_FORMAT",
    "localeCode": "en_US",
    "marketplaceId": "A2EUQ1WTGCTBG2",
    "mskuQuantities": [
        {
            "msku": "msku",
            "quantity": 5
        }
    ],
    "pageType": "A4_21",
    "width": 100
}

Responses

🟢200OK
application/json
CreateMarketplaceItemLabels 200 response
Headers
x-amzn-RequestId
string 
optional
Unique request reference identifier.
x-amzn-RateLimit-Limit
string 
optional
Your rate limit (requests per second) for this operation.
Body
The `createMarketplaceItemLabels` response.
documentDownloads
array[object (DocumentDownload) {3}] 
required
Resources to download the requested document.
downloadType
string 
required
The type of download. Possible values: URL.
expiration
string <date-time>
optional
The URI's expiration time. In ISO 8601 datetime format with pattern yyyy-MM-ddTHH:mm:ss.sssZ.
uri
string 
required
Uniform resource identifier to identify where the document is located.
Example
{
    "documentDownloads": [
        {
            "downloadType": "string",
            "expiration": "2019-08-24T14:15:22Z",
            "uri": "string"
        }
    ]
}
